Rose likes the sunRose likes the sun and is a sun-loving plant. It is suitable for growing in an environment with good lighting conditions. Rose cannot be without sunlight. If it is not exposed to sunlight, the plant will be susceptible to disease and the growth rate will also slow down. It is better to see more sunlight. It is generally beneficial to expose it to the sun in the morning or afternoon and evening. Rose basking in the sunRose needs sunlight. It is not afraid of the sun and can grow in the sun for a long time. However, it should be avoided from being exposed to the sun. If the temperature is too high and the light is too strong, it can easily cause the flowers and leaves to be burned. Rose LightRoses need light all the time during their growth process. Soft and long-lasting light is best. If the roses are newly repotted, you should reduce the light exposure appropriately to slow down the rate of photosynthesis. At the same time, reducing light can weaken transpiration and reduce the plant's water consumption from all aspects. When the roots can absorb water normally in the new soil, normal light can be given. What to do if roses wilt in the sunIf the rose is wilted by the sun, try to move it indoors or to a cool environment, then spray the leaves with water to quickly replenish the water lost due to excessive sunlight and reduce damage to the plant due to water loss. |
